1. Formulation of physicochemical problems, 2. Definition and classification of differential equations 3. Solution of elementary ordinary differential equations 4. Solution methods of partial differential equations 5. Series solution methods and special functions 6. Bessel functions an equations 7. Seperation of variables methods for partial differential equations 8. Combination of variables solutions for partial differential equations 9. Laplace transformation methods for solving partial differentials solutions 10. Application of these methods to chemical engineering problems.
